Fan-out backpressure for the Quillet notifier: when the queue depth crosses the soft limit, the dispatcher sheds low-priority pushes and batches the rest at 500ms intervals. Reviewer should confirm the shed counter is exported and that retries respect the jitter window. Once merged, the release artifact gets re-signed by the pipeline, which expects the deploy key shown below.

deploy key for bawep-yawif: bky6_GQhaSt

Ticket: Staging env misconfigured for Siftgate bloom filter

The bloom layer in front of the Pellet KV store is rejecting all lookups in staging because the env file was copied from the dev template without credentials. False-positive tuning values are fine; only the auth line is missing. To unblock the weekly demo, the Pellet admission secret must be set on the following line.

env line for yaguf-fajop: LEDGER_TOKEN13=fb08984397349

## Authentication

The Farewedge pricing experiment service requires a key on every request via the standard auth header. Keys are environment-scoped; staging keys will not work against the experiment allocator in prod. Reviewer note: the client reads the key from config at startup, never from env at call time — flag any PR that changes this. Rotation is monthly, handled by the platform crew. The current staging key is below.

gateway credential: kto23_LX9A4ys6i4nzHtpOLNLodKK

## Changelog — Week of the Lintpocalypse

Shipped v0.9 of Proseweld, our docs linter. It now catches broken cross-references, stale version strings, and headings that skip levels. Yes, it flagged 340 issues in the Kestrelbook docs on day one — most are real, sorry. Autofix covers about half; the rest need human eyes. CI enforcement starts next sprint, warnings only for now. Questions, complaints, and exemption requests at the sync should go to the project lead.

named custodian: Brivan Eliath Quenox Frador